首页英语词典inextricableinextricable英英释意

inextricable

英 [ɪn'ekstrɪkəb(ə)l; ,ɪnɪk'strɪk-; ,ɪnek-] 美['ɪnɪk'strɪkəbl]
  • adj. 逃脱不掉的;解不开的

英英释意


1. not permitting extrication; incapable of being disentangled or untied;
"an inextricable knot"
"inextricable unity"